Sanjay Leela Bhansali asked Ameesha Patel to retire after watching Gadar (2001)

Ameesha Patel

Actress Ameesha Patel is currently basking in the remarkable success of her recent blockbuster, Gadar 2. Returning to her cherished role as Sakeena after 22 years, she has once again captured the hearts of audiences. Her on-screen chemistry with Sunny Deol stands as a significant highlight of the film. The iconic songs recreated from the original have also evoked a sense of nostalgia. This triumph is reminiscent of her experience when the first instalment of Gadar hit screens in 2001, marking only her second Hindi film. Ameesha Patel recently recounted an intriguing incident from that time after the release of Gadar: Ek Prem Katha, where she shared how acclaimed director Sanjay Leela Bhansali advised her to retire after witnessing the film’s impact.

In a candid interview with an Indian publication, the stunning actress delved into how her life underwent transformation post the releases of “Kaho Naa Pyaar Hai” and “Gadar.” She recounted a moment involving Sanjay Leela Bhansali, known for his directorial works like “Devdas” and “Hum Dil De Chuke Sanam.” In 2001, after viewing the original Gadar, Bhansali penned a heartfelt letter of praise to Ameesha Patel. During a subsequent meeting, he candidly advised her to retire. Ameesha shared, “After watching Gadar, Sanjay Leela Bhansali wrote a really beautiful complimentary letter to me, and when I had a meeting with him, he said ‘Ameesha, you should retire now.’ I was like ‘why?’ I didn’t understand.”

Continuing, Ameesha revealed Bhansali’s reasoning, “He said, ‘Because you have already achieved in two films which most people don’t achieve in their entire career. Once in a lifetime a ‘Mughal-e-Azam,’ ‘Mother India,’ ‘Pakeezah,’ ‘Sholay’ get made, you had it in your second film, so what next?’ I didn’t understand it at that time because I was a kid, I was so new to the film world (to know) what he meant by setting the bar high.” Over time, Ameesha came to realize the implications of his words as all her subsequent films, whether successful or not, were consistently measured against the benchmark of Gadar, which posed a challenge for her.

Imran Abbas Expresses Joy For Ameesha Patel Amidst Success Of ‘Gadar 2’

Imran Abbas

The connection shared between two actors often goes beyond the cinematic realm, as demonstrated by Pakistani actor Imran Abbas, who recently extended his congratulations to his longtime friend and Indian star Ameesha Patel for the success of her latest movie, Gadar 2. This heartening interaction not only underscores their enduring friendship but also emphasizes that camaraderie within the entertainment industry transcends national borders.

On Instagram, Imran conveyed his sentiment by writing, “So happy for you, Ameesha,” along with tagging the Gadar 2 star in his Instagram Story. This uncomplicated yet deeply meaningful message resonated with their fans, showcasing the genuine support and bond between the two actors.

However, in response to queries from critics, Imran Abbas clarified, “I am happy for her comeback since she is my very dear friend. People are misinterpreting it to troll me because Gadar 2 is an anti-Pakistan subject.”

Imran Abbas and Ameesha became the centre of attention in 2022 when a viral video sparked speculations about a romantic relationship between them. Nonetheless, it was clarified that their friendship story dates back years, originating when they were fellow students in the United States. While pursuing their academic aspirations, they formed a strong connection that has endured the test of time. Their deep bond was once again in the spotlight when they were seen together in Bahrain, rekindling their friendship in a heartwarming reunion.

Ameesha dismissed rumors about them dating, telling Hindustan Times, “I read them too and had a huge laugh about it. The whole thing is just crazy and full of silliness. I was meeting my buddy after so many years. So, it was just a catch-up.” The actor of “Kaho Naa… Pyaar Hai” also discussed the aforementioned viral video, which she later shared on her Instagram. “He happens to love that song of mine. It’s his favourite song… We just did an impromptu thing, which was recorded by a friend. It came out so cute, so we posted it. It was not planned,” she further explained.

Further elaborating on their relationship, Ameesha stated, “We have known each other for many years, since the time I studied with him at a university in the US. And I have stayed in touch with most of my friends in Pakistan, who just love India. Imran Abbas belongs to the film industry there, and we have a lot more to talk about.” The stars continue to support one another long after their initial reunion.

Does Hrithik Roshan have a major illness?

Hrithik Roshan
  • Hrithik Roshan was papped outside a bone-marrow transplant clinic in Mumbai.
  • The Krrish actor is known to be one of Bollywood’s most handsome super-fit heroes.
  • He suffered head injuries that required surgery to remove a blood clot from his brain.

Hrithik Roshan, who is well-known as one of Bollywood’s most appealing and physically fit heroes and constantly encourages his followers to lead healthy lives through exercise and a nutritious diet, startled the internet when he was photographed outside a bone-marrow transplant center in Mumbai.
Fans of the 49-year-old expressed their amazement and anxiety after learning that the Krrish star was consulting a doctor because the actor is a representation of physical fitness.

The actor from Kaho Naa Pyaar Hai reportedly visited a bone marrow transplant centre because of an injury sustained a few years ago, according to media reports. He sustained head injuries during filming Roshan’s movie Bang Bang, which necessitated surgery to remove a blood clot from his brain that had been there for two months. Roshan has undergone routine bone marrow examinations ever after the surgery.

The Kites star recently opened up about his struggle with depression. The Jodha Akbar actor discussed how he frequently felt like falling and recalled the time he made the decision to make significant changes.

Roshan said, “I feel as light and as fast as our last transformation. I thought I was dying when I was doing War. I wasn’t prepared for the film and I was up against a really big challenge. I was trying to achieve perfection for which I wasn’t ready.”

The star added, “After the film, I went into adrenaline fatigue. For 3-4 months, I couldn’t train and wasn’t feeling good. I was almost on the verge of depression. I was completely lost and that’s when I knew I needed to make a change in my life”.
